What will your day look like?
**As the FAR Governance Manager, you will be responsible for**:

- Supporting the design, implementation and continuous evolution of Financial Accountability Regime (FAR) governance framework, policies, strategic initiatives and practices for our accountable entities, and
- Partnering with accountable persons and their support teams to implement and embed the FAR within ANZ GHL and ANZ BGL.

Your key accountabilities in this role will include supporting the Senior FAR Governance Manager to:

- Maintain the accountable entity’s accountability map, accountable person accountability statements, accountable person responsibility maps
- Provide support to the accountable persons FAR representatives, and
- Report to the accountable entity, their accountable persons and other key governance arrangements on FAR.
